Bus stop flag at Albert and Empress (stop 2392) incorrectly displays "16 Tunney's Pasture/Barrhaven". It has displayed this since the late summer, when it was changed. I see this everyday riding the 16 Westboro.

Bus stop at Lees and Springhurst Park/Lees Station (stop 7183, displayed on the NSAS as "169 Lees") incorrectly displays "16 Tunney's Pasture/Terry Fox". Saw this last week, while riding the 56 King Edward.

 

The flag at Mackenzie King Westbound used to also display "Terry Fox" as the second destination for the Westbound 16. I took this photo on October 6, 2019.

image.thumb.png.5d1c0ac7345ca090fe92178f8fcbee50.png

It has since been corrected (they put a "Tunney's Pasture/Westboro" sticker over the incorrect destinations, after I informed a supervisor at Tunney's about the issue). I took this photo on February 16, 2020.

image.thumb.png.0440f0818f7a761d95ee7027ba241557.png

 

There also used to be an issue at Bayview A of the same type regarding the 16; that 16 incorrectly went to Barrhaven. It has long since been fixed.

In addition, there used to be an issue at Lyon A regarding the 16 as well; that 16 incorrectly went to Terry Fox. That one likely has been fixed.
